Introduction:

In today's fast-paced world, the traditional 9-5 time-table not relates to many families. Aided by the increase of dual-income households and non-traditional work hours, the need for 24-hour daycare solutions was steadily increasing. 24-hour daycare centers offer moms and dads the flexibility they should balance work and family duties, and offer a safe and nurturing environment for kids around the clock.

Advantages of 24-Hour Daycare:

Among the crucial advantages of 24-hour daycare could be the mobility it provides working moms and dads. Numerous parents work shifts that extend beyond traditional daycare hours, which makes it difficult to get childcare that suits their particular routine. 24-hour daycare centers solve this issue by providing attention during nights, vacations, and even immediately. This allows moms and dads to work without fretting about finding someone to watch kids during non-traditional hours.

Another advantage of 24-hour daycare is the reassurance it provides to parents. Knowing that their children are now being looked after by trained specialists in a safe and protected environment can alleviate the tension and shame that often is sold with leaving children in daycare. Parents can concentrate on their work understanding that kids come in good hands, that could trigger increased productivity and work pleasure.

Also, 24-hour daycare centers provides a sense of community and assistance for families. Moms and dads whom work non-traditional hours usually struggle to find childcare choices that meet their needs, ultimately causing thoughts of isolation and anxiety. 24-hour daycare facilities could possibly offer a sense of belonging and camaraderie among parents dealing with similar challenges, generating a support community which will help people thrive.

Difficulties of 24-Hour Daycare:

While 24-hour daycare facilities offer advantages, in addition they have their very own collection of difficulties. One of the primary challenges is staffing. Finding competent and dependable childcare providers that happy to work non-traditional hours are tough, resulting in high turnover rates and potential staffing shortages. This may affect the caliber of attention provided to children and produce instability for people depending on 24-hour daycare solutions.

Another challenge of 24-hour daycare is the price. Providing attention around the clock calls for extra staffing and sources, which can drive up the price of services. This could be a barrier for low-income families who may possibly not be in a position to manage 24-hour Daycare Near Me, making them with minimal alternatives for childcare during non-traditional hours.

Regulation and Oversight:

So that you can make sure the safety and well-being of kids in 24-hour daycare centers, legislation and oversight are necessary. State and local governments set standards for licensing and certification of daycare facilities, including those who function 24 hours a day. These standards cover an array of areas, including staff-to-child ratios, safe practices requirements, and staff instruction and skills.

And government regulations, numerous 24-hour daycare facilities elect to seek accreditation from national businesses like the nationwide Association when it comes to Education of Young Children (NAEYC) or perhaps the National Association for Family Child Care (NAFCC). Accreditation shows a consignment to top-quality attention and that can help moms and dads feel confident in their range of childcare provider.
